### The Bar Chart: Stacking the Evidence
Bar charts are one of the oldest and most common types of data visualization. These charts use rectangular bars to compare different groups of data, making it easy to see how quantities vary between groups.
#### Vertical vs. Horizontal Bars
Vertical bar charts generally illustrate data changes over time while horizontal bars are more suitable when comparing different categories. For instance, vertical bar charts can effectively demonstrate sales figures by month, while horizontal charts might be the better choice when comparing the number of attendees at various events.
#### Single vs. Grouped
Bar charts can be divided into two main categories: single and grouped.
– **Single Bar Charts**: Represent a single piece of data (e.g., the sales figure for a specific product).
– **Grouped Bar Charts**: Accommodate multiple series or subgroups within a single category (e.g., sales figures for different products within a particular month).
The choice between these formats largely depends on the nature of the data and the story one aims to tell. Often, grouped bar charts are better for highlighting individual trends when multiple series overlap, while single bars can clarify detailed comparisons.
### The Line Chart: Picturing Change
Line charts, on the other hand, are ideal for displaying changes in data over a period of time based on continuous numeric values.
#### Types of Line Charts
– **Simple Line Charts**: Display data points connected with straight lines, typically used to show change over a short period (like daily stock prices).
– **Stacked Line Charts**: Combine different data series and stack them on top of each other, useful when comparing how multiple trends contribute to the overall change over time.
– **Smoothed Line Charts**: Utilize a best-fit line (often a polynomial regression line) to smooth out variations in data, making it easier to detect trends.
### Interpreting Line and Bar Charts
When using these charts, it’s crucial to consider the following tips:
– **Scale**: The axes should be appropriately scaled to reflect the data accurately. Avoid misrepresenting data with exaggerated or compressed scales.
– **Labeling**: Ensure that all axes, legend, and data points are clearly labeled to avoid confusion and maintain clarity.
– **Design**: Maintain a consistent and visually appealing chart design. Keep the color scheme minimal and consistent with the overall style of your report or presentation.
### Beyond Bar and Line Charts: The Data Landscape
While bar and line charts are powerful, they’re just the tip of the data visualization iceberg. Here are some other key chart types:
#### Pie Charts: The Full Circle
Pie charts are excellent for showing proportional or quantitative data. When used correctly, they can be highly effective at highlighting the largest or smallest contributions to the whole.
#### Scatter Plots: Finding Correlation
These charts map individual data points on a two-dimensional plane to illustrate relationships between two variables. Scatter plots are useful in statistical analysis to identify correlations or trends.
#### Heat Maps: Color the Way to Insight
Heat maps use color gradients to represent values in a two-dimensional dataset. They are particularly powerful for exploring large amounts of data with subtle differences, like geographical data or complex data matrices.
